Danville city Conventional Mortgage Overview

For Danville city conventional buyers, the 24.06% weighted average down payment reflects strong credit profiles, as this equity level typically eliminates the need for Private Mortgage Insurance (PMI). With a median Loan-to-Value (LTV) of 75.94%, buyers already possess over 20% equity, avoiding PMI entirely. The 0.62% property tax rate on a $262,624 average property equates to roughly $136 monthly, while the 1.1% inflation-adjusted tax increase adds minimal pressure. This data, based on 100% primary occupancy, confirms stable, owner-occupied demand.
